SINGAPORE -- The COVID-19 pandemic has energized Southeast Asia's startup ecosystem, with increasing numbers of companies attaining unicorn valuations while closing in on IPOs. This has attracted venture capitalists looking to seed promising next-generation startups that might become the next Grab or Gojek.
